我按照你的配置依旧报错Exception in thread "main" java.lang.UnsupportedOperationException
时间: 2023-07-24 16:04:13 浏览: 141
非常抱歉给你带来了困扰。根据你提供的信息,似乎仍然存在问题。
在 InfluxDB Camel 组件中,`operation` 参数并不支持直接指定数据点的字段和标签。你需要使用 `headers` 或 `body` 来传递数据点的信息。
以下是一个示例配置,展示了如何使用 `headers` 传递数据点的信息:
```yaml
to:
uri: influxdb2:influxDBConnectBean
id: to-3799
parameters:
bridgeEndpoint: true
connectionBean: "#influxDBConnectBean"
bucket: my-bucket
org: my-org
operation: write
headers:
CamelInfluxDbMeasurementName: shelf1
CamelInfluxDbFields: testField=10
CamelInfluxDbTags: factory=F1,building=B2,area=A3,item=Part4
```
在上面的配置中,我们使用了 `headers` 分别指定了测量值(`CamelInfluxDbMeasurementName`)、字段(`CamelInfluxDbFields`)和标签(`CamelInfluxDbTags`)。
请确保你的代码中正确设置了这些头信息,并根据你的需求进行相应的配置。
如果你仍然遇到问题,请提供更多的代码和错误信息,以便我能更好地帮助你解决问题。
阅读全文